The operation of the saw consists of an automatic sequence of
events.
To start the saw the main power must be on and the appro-
priate air supply to the machine. With the power on, the
control panel will have the power on light illuminated.
To start the saw motor, push the start button.
Once the saw motor is started, push the yellow manual cut
button and the machine will start its automatic cycle. The
clamps will come down and the table will begin to travel
away from its home position. Immediately after this hap-
pens, the saw pivot assembly will raise the blade up
through the table slot until it reaches its up limit switch.
Upon reaching this switch, the saw pivot will immediately
return down through the table, the clamps will raise and the
table will return to its home position, completing one
cycle.

IMPORTANT: An important reminder is that the speed
settings of the pneumatic flow controls will affect the
cycle time of the machine. The flow controls must be set
properly to a compromise between cycle time and cut
quality. Flow control settings should be adjusted at this
time and fine-tuned during the initial phase of the saw
operation.
